ip pim rp-address

Configure a static PIM rendezvous point (RP) address for a group or access-list.
S4810
Syntax
ip pim rp-address address {group-address group-address mask}
override
To remove an RP address, use the no ip pim rp-address address {group-
address group-address mask} override command.

Enter the RP address in dotted decimal format (A.B.C.D).
Enter the keywords group-address then a group-address
mask, in dotted decimal format (/xx), to assign that group
address to the RP.
Enter the keyword override to override the BSR updates
with static RP. The override takes effect immediately during
enable/disable.
NOTE: This option is applicable to multicast group range.
